Introduction to Latin Music: Origins, Evolution, and Cultural Impact
Latin music refers to a wide variety of music genres originating from Latin America, the Caribbean, and Spain. The term 'Latin' broadly covers music styles that include elements from indigenous, African, and European musical traditions. Its history dates back to the early colonial period when African slaves, European settlers, and indigenous peoples began to mix their musical traditions. Over the centuries, Latin music has evolved, incorporating new influences and giving rise to diverse genres such as salsa, reggaeton, bachata, tango, and more. Today, Latin music is a global phenomenon, influencing popular music worldwide.
Sub-tags and Classifications of Latin Music
Salsa
Salsa music emerged in the 1960s in New York, with roots in Cuban and Puerto Rican music. It blends Afro-Cuban rhythms with jazz and other musical elements, creating an energetic and rhythmic sound. Salsa has become one of the most popular Latin dance music genres worldwide, characterized by its syncopated beats, brass sections, and call-and-response vocal style.
Reggaeton
Reggaeton is a genre that blends Latin rhythms with hip hopLatin Music Overview, dancehall, and electronic music. It originated in Puerto Rico in the late 1990s and is known for its catchy, repetitive beats and lyrics in Spanish. Reggaeton has become a dominant force in global pop music, with artists like Daddy Yankee and Bad Bunny taking the genre to international success.
Bachata
Bachata originated in the Dominican Republic in the early 20th century. It is characterized by its romantic and melancholic themes, often dealing with love and heartbreak. The music typically features guitar, bongo drums, and maracas, with a distinctive rhythm that makes it ideal for intimate partner dances. Bachata gained international popularity in the 1990s, and artists like Romeo Santos helped globalize the genre.
Tango
Tango music has its origins in the Rio de la Plata region of Argentina and Uruguay. It is recognized for its dramatic and passionate sound, often involving the bandoneon (a type of accordion) and violins. Tango is not only a music genre but also a style of dance that has gained worldwide recognition, particularly in Europe and North America. The genre has evolved, with artists like Carlos Gardel contributing to its rise in the 20th century.
Flamenco
Flamenco is a deeply emotional and expressive music and dance form that originated in Andalusia, Spain. It combines singing (cante), guitar playing (toque), and dancing (baile) into an intense, passionate performance. Flamenco's roots lie in the Gypsy, Jewish, and Moorish cultures of Spain, and it has evolved through various styles, including classical flamenco and contemporary fusions.
Famous Latin Artists and Iconic Works
Carlos Santana
Carlos Santana is a Mexican-American guitarist known for his Latin-inspired rock music. His breakthrough album, 'Supernatural,' blends rock with Latin rhythms and jazz influences, featuring hits like 'Smooth' and 'Maria Maria.' Santana's unique fusion of Latin, jazz, and rock music has earned him worldwide recognition and numerous Grammy Awards.
La Cumparsita
La Cumparsita is one of the most famous tango compositions of all time, composed by Gerardo Matos Rodríguez in 1916. The piece is known for its melancholic and dramatic melody, which captures the passionate and tragic spirit of tango. 'La Cumparsita' has been interpreted by countless orchestras and artists, becoming an emblematic work that represents the heart and soul of tango music.
Shakira
Shakira is a Colombian singer and songwriter whose work blends pop, rock, and Latin music. Her global hits like 'Hips Don't Lie' and 'La Tortura' have brought Latin music to mainstream pop audiences worldwide. Shakira's innovative use of Latin rhythms and fusion with global pop trends has made her one of the most influential Latin artists of the 21st century.
Oye Como Va
Oye Como Va is a Latin jazz song composed by Tito Puente and popularized by Santana in the 1970s. The song's infectious rhythm, catchy melody, and fusion of Latin percussion with rock guitar made it an international hit. Santana's version, in particular, introduced Latin jazz to rock audiences, becoming a cultural touchstone for Latin music in the U.S. and beyond.
Ricky Martin
Ricky Martin is a Puerto Rican singer who brought Latin pop into the global spotlight with his hit 'Livin' La Vida Loca.' Known for his catchy tunes and infectious energy, Ricky Martin helped shape the Latin pop movement of the late 1990s and 2000s. His ability to merge Latin music with global pop has made him an international superstar.
Bailando
Bailando is a 2014 hit song by Enrique Iglesias featuring Sean Paul, Descemer Bueno, and Gente de Zona. It became one of the most popular Latin songs of the 21st century, with its fusion of reggaeton, dancehall, and traditional Latin rhythms. The song’s success helped reinforce the international popularity of reggaeton and Latin pop, making it a key moment in modern Latin music history.
Bad Bunny
Bad Bunny is a Puerto Rican reggaeton and Latin trap artist who has become a leader of the genre. His album 'YHLQMDLG' and singles like 'Safaera' have pushed Latin music into the mainstream, especially among younger audiences. Bad Bunny's bold experimentation with sounds and his unapologetic approach to lyrics and style have reshaped the modern Latin music landscape.
